Big Hand Cast Bronze Bell Bold with a most pleasant resonating sound Beautiful resonating ring tones await the new owner of this big one-of-a-kind vintage bronze bell from old Japan. Its beautiful natural patina makes it an attractive and desirable work of art. This distinctive dragon headed bell called ryuzu and remarkable protrusions called chi chi or nyu are crafted by generations old skilled Japanese specialists to improve sound resonance and are unique to Japan's ancient traditions. This vintage hand cast bronze temple bell dates to the middle Showa period, mid-20th century. A scarce survivor, this rugged bell was gently used. Please note its impressive cast dragon headed top ryuzu, thick walls and original blue gray toned patina. Dimensions: 18 inches tall and 10 inches diameter. It has been used and possesses an original aged patina appropriate to its age-just the way we like to find them. Its beautiful resonating sound is guaranteed to please you. The ringing resonation of this bell brings to the Japanese people - the voice of Buddha- is even more impressive because of its thick walls (see photo). Its sound and voice of Buddha was used to deliver wishes to the temples patrons and followers. Unique. Great garden consideration. Only One. We will also include a complimentary hand striker.
